China has emerged as a global leader in the export of advanced residential solar systems, thanks to its unwavering commitment to innovation and technology. According to the International Energy Agency (IEA), China's share of global solar PV installations reached an impressive 44% in 2022. This surge is attributed to the country’s investment in research and development, which has allowed Chinese manufacturers to produce high-efficiency solar panels that often boast conversion efficiencies upwards of 23%, as reported by Wood Mackenzie.
Success stories of Chinese solar technology can be seen worldwide. For instance, in Germany, several homeowners have reported significant reductions in energy costs after adopting Chinese solar systems, which are now integral to the country’s energy transition initiatives. A study by the Solar Energy Industries Association (SEIA) revealed that systems utilizing these innovative Chinese technologies have led to a 30% increase in energy yield. Additionally, projects in markets such as Australia and the United States highlight the growing trust and reliance on Chinese technology, as these systems not only offer superior performance but also come at competitive pricing, further driving their global adoption.
China's solar systems are increasingly recognized for their advanced technology and efficiency, often outperforming competitors in various metrics. Recent reports indicate that floating solar photovoltaic systems, a technology developing rapidly in China, can yield energy output that surpasses traditional land-based installations by up to 15%. This positions China at the forefront of technological innovation in solar energy, showcasing a significant competitive advantage in both efficiency and space utilization.
Simultaneously, the dynamics of the global energy market continue to evolve amid geopolitical tensions. The U.S.-China trade relationship has been marked by increased scrutiny on solar imports, with policies that may inadvertently boost domestic solar manufacturers in the U.S. As per insights from recent studies, Indian solar equipment makers are also positioned to leverage these shifts, potentially gaining an edge against Chinese producers in the U.S. market. This competitive landscape highlights the necessity for ongoing advancements and strategic investments in research and development, especially as nations strive to solidify their foothold in the renewable energy sector amidst international rivalry.
